Languages of Veth
AlesianAnkenahAnkenah is less a language and more a magical system! Created by Tekhem "Ankenahotep" as-Tyrakhon, this system of glyphs aims to distill the essence of the world and universe into linguistic forms. Its daughter language, Najjira, is the native language of the Najjira people. AslarThe Aslar is native to the kingdom of Aslar (which is famous for its tradition of electing a new king each year and beheading the old one). AssiAssi is the language of the deeply spiritual and very ferocious Assi tribesmen of the Nie River Valley. ArangothekArangothek is the official language of Arangoth and Drache, in which BDI itself is located. CommonBetter known to us as English, this is the most commonly used language in both BDI and in active play in general. GriffonSpoken widely in Griffon's Aerie and in any place where its people congregate, Griffon is quite commonly heard in both Drache and any other large port town. KorthaiKorthai is the language of the seagoing Korthai people, who are cousins of the Assi. |

Scripts of the World
Several of the languages of Veth have been given their own scripts. Languages with bolded names have (a) usable and learnable writing system(s). AnkenahAnkenah, the magical language which spawned modern Najji, originally used a set of ideographs to try and capture the essence of the universe in order to distill it into something understandable and usable by human beings. ArangothekArangothek has its own writing, which you can see explained here. AssiThe Assi language apparently uses a system of ideograms. TeldanarThe desert-living Teldanar use an as-of-yet-unexpounded-upon heiroglyphic writing system. |
